Cash Bail Bonds
Safeguarding a release from prison commonly includes the usage of money bail bonds, which require the offender or their agent to pay the full bail amount in money to the court. This method is simple and entails the offender being released from custodianship once the cash is paid, supplied that the bail is established by the judge. Cash bail bonds are typically used for defendants that have the funds to manage the total bail quantity upfront.
The primary benefit of cash money bail bonds is the instant release of the offender, permitting them to return to their normal life while waiting for test. Furthermore, once the case is fixed, the bail amount is reimbursed to the individual that published it, presuming all court looks are made. If the accused stops working to show up, the court may forfeit the cash, resulting in a financial loss.
It is essential for offenders to comprehend the effects of using money bail bonds, consisting of the potential financial problem of tying up substantial funds up until the instance ends. Therefore, exploring all bail choices, including the financial expediency of paying cash money bail, is important for notified decision-making.
Guaranty Bail Bonds
Guaranty bail bonds give an alternate to cash bail by allowing a 3rd party, normally a bond bondsman, to guarantee the complete bail amount on behalf of the accused. This plan allows people who might not have the economic means to pay the complete bail quantity upfront to protect their launch from protection while awaiting test.
When a defendant chooses a surety bail bond, they normally pay the bail bondsman a non-refundable cost, typically around 10% of the complete bail amount. In exchange, the bondsman assumes the financial danger and pledges the full bail quantity to the court. If the offender falls short to stand for their arranged court days, the bondsman is in charge of paying the complete bail total up to the court and might pursue the offender to recoup losses.
Guaranty bail bonds can be especially beneficial in situations where the bail quantity is considerable, allowing offenders to keep their liberty throughout lawful procedures. Nevertheless, it is crucial for accuseds to totally understand the terms and problems of the contract with the bail bondsman to avoid possible complications.

Federal Bail Bonds
Federal bail bonds work as a critical mechanism for offenders encountering federal charges to protect their launch from protection while waiting for trial. Unlike state charges, federal offenses generally involve a lot more complex legal procedures, which can result in prolonged pretrial apprehension. A government bail bond guarantees that the defendant will certainly appear in any way called for court hearings, thus minimizing the threat to the judicial procedure.

The expense of a federal bail bond typically ranges from 10% to 15% of the overall bail amount, which is non-refundable. Furthermore, security may be called for to safeguard the bond, more making certain the defendant's conformity with court appearances. Understanding the complexities of government bail bonds can considerably affect an offender's capacity to browse the legal system properly.
